Commercial pedestrian gates help manage foot traffic, protect restricted areas and improve overall site security. From staff entrances and service walkways to public access points, the right pedestrian gate setup supports safe movement while preventing unauthorised entry.

Pedestrian gate at commercial perimeter

If a turnstile is not the pedestrian option you are looking for, we do also offer semi-automated pedestrian gates. If pedestrian access is at the same point as vehicle access on your site this is the perfect option to go along side one of our vehicle gates to allow safe entry for pedestrians.

Fitted with a mag lock – no one will be able to enter or exit until the mag lock is released. This will be controlled by any access control of your choice upon entry, then usually just a guarded push button for an easy exit, guarded to deny accessibility to the button from outside. Auto closers are always fitted.

Like any mechanical or automated system, pedestrian gates benefit from periodic servicing. Regular inspections help ensure hinges, locks, motors, and safety components continue to operate reliably and can extend the overall lifespan of the gate.
